An e-commerce company uses AI-powered analytics on its database to generate real-time product suggestions based on customer history, clicks, and purchases. This increases average order value and user engagement.
Healthcare: Patient Data Management
Hospitals use AI to clean and standardize large volumes of patient data, improving the accuracy of diagnosis and treatment plans. AI also flags anomalies, such as incorrect medication dosages or unusual lab results.
Banking: Fraud Detection
Banks rely on AI to monitor transactional databases. When a suspicious pattern (e.g., large withdrawals or login attempts from foreign IPs) is detected, the system instantly flags the activity or blocks the transaction.

The Future of AI in Database Management
As AI models become more sophisticated and integrated with cloud and edge computing, we can expect:
AI-native databases built from the ground up with intelligence at their core.
Conversational data interfaces using voice and chatbots.
Autonomous data platforms that not only manage but also strategically act on data.
Federated learning allowing AI to learn across decentralized data sources without compromising privacy.
